Welcome to Arches B&B, a cozy and charming bed and breakfast located in the beautiful city of St Austell, United Kingdom. Situated just 1mi from the city center, this B&B offers convenience and a peaceful atmosphere for travelers seeking a relaxing stay. With 302 fantastic reviews, guests can rest assured that their stay at Arches B&B will be nothing short of exceptional.

Starting at just $47 per night, this budget-friendly accommodation provides great value for money. The address of Arches B&B is 78 Bodmin Road, making it easily accessible and convenient for guests. The B&B offers a range of amenities, including free Wi-Fi, private parking, and a complimentary breakfast to start your day off right.

At Arches B&B, you'll find all the comforts of home, from the well-appointed rooms with cozy beds and private bathrooms, to the sun deck where you can relax and enjoy the view. Pet lovers will be pleased to know that the B&B is pet-friendly, with some additional charges. 🇬🇧

Steven

10

June 2023

Nikki was a kind and attentive host and very accommodating. Merlin the dog was a lovely character and very well behaved. The breakfast was delicious: kippers were top notch and Nikki really knows how to poach an egg - they were absolutely perfect! The rooms were charming and clean and ours had an amazing view of the viaduct which gives the B&B its name. Loved the colour coding of the rooms right down to the toiletries - lovely touch. Appreciated the various facilities too. Overall, better value and far more fun than a Travelodge.

🇬🇧

Russell

10

May 2023

A lovely stay in a comfortable room and comfy bed within a historic home. I stayed in the Green Room with an ensuite and a four poster bed! The host, Nicki, is wonderfully accommodating and her dog is good natured. The B&B itself is well-located close to St. Austell town centre, the station and walking trails to the likes of the Eden Project. Unfortunately, as a consequence it is a bit noisy being close to a main road, but that can't be helped. The breakfast was tasty too and good value for money (£7.50) if you don't book it in advance.

Frequently Asked Questions - Arches B&B

Is it possible to stay with my pet at Arches B&B?

Yes, you can bring your pet with you to Arches B&B as they allow pets on request. However, please note that there may be additional charges for having a pet stay with you.

What are the check-in and check-out times at Arches B&B?

While the stay at Arches B&B offers a flexible check-in window between 04:00 PM and 09:30 PM, the check-out is fixed at 10:00 AM.

Is free parking available at Arches B&B?

Yes, there is ample parking available at Arches B&B. Guests can enjoy the convenience of free, private on-site parking without the need for any reservations.
